Rehabilitation counselors help people deal with the personal, social, and vocational effects of disabilities. They counsel people with disabilities resulting from birth defects, illness or disease, accidents, or the stress of daily life. They evaluate the strengths and limitations of individuals, provide personal and vocational counseling, and arrange for medical care, independent living, vocational training and job placement. The scope of problems in the rehabilitation field is expanding and the number of individuals with disabilities is increasing. As the nature of services becomes more complex, opportunities in recent years have been excellent in all area of rehabilitation counseling.

School counselors work in K-12 educational settings to assist with the educational, vocation, personal, and social development of all students. In carrying out their responsibilities, school counselors work with students, parents, teachers, school personnel and community agencies.
Individuals already possessing a master's degree in counseling, psychology, human development, education, special education, social work, or any other mental health field at another institution may qualify for licensure certificate program status. This program requires students to complete the equivalent of our degree program through transfer courses and courses taken at St. Cloud State University. Specified courses must be taken from SCSU. The Marriage and Family Therapy certificate program provides academic and experiential training needed to prepare students for Marriage and Family Therapy licensure. This is an optional program that builds upon the existing Community Counseling program.
Marriage and Family Therapy views and treats individuals seeking psychotherapeutic assistance as existing within a complex set of relationships. The Master of Science program in Marriage and Family Therapy provides academic and experiential training needed to prepare students for Marriage and Family Therapy licensure. To be admitted to the Marriage and Family Therapy focus the applicant must successfully complete a personal interview process with faculty from the Marriage and Family Therapy training program. Careful attention will be given to previous work experience, academic background, scholarship, interpersonal skills and committed to the field of Marriage and Family Therapy.

The Department of Special Education offers program plans leading to a Master of Science degree. The student's program of study may be designed to emphasize education of the developmentally disabled, the specific learning disabled, the emotionally/behaviorally disordered, the mildly handicapped (master consultingteacher), or the gifted and talented. An early childhood/special needs licensure is also available in a joint program with the Department of Child and Family Studies. An introductory course on the education of exceptional children is required for admission to this program.

The graduate program in communication disorders (CDIS) is accredited by the American Speech-Language-Hearing Association. Students earning a Master of Science degree will have completed the academic course work and clinical experiences that make them eligible to apply for the ASHA Certificate of Clinical Competence in Speech-Language Pathology. The Department of Communication Disorders does not offer a graduate degree in audiology. Graduates have enjoyed professional employment in a variety of settings including: elementary and secondary schools, hospitals, rehabilitation centers, and private practice.

The Master of Music program in Conducting is designed to improve the musical knowledge and conducting/teaching skills of conductors by:
Engaging them in the study of score preparation, expressive conducting technique, rehearsal techniques, programming, and video-tape analysis;
Strengthening their expertise in literature (choral, orchestral, or wind band), history, analytical techniques and pedagogy;
Providing them the opportunity to pursue an area of interest in research and/or performance.
Student conductors may direct their own performing group or an on-campus ensemble in a supervised performance as the culminating creative project for the degree.
